ZIP 91941 is home to a population of 33,706 residents, making it a moderately sized community with a suburban feel. These individuals are distributed across 12,689 households, reflecting a mix of family units, singles, and retirees. With 13,250 total housing units in the area, there’s a slight surplus of homes compared to households, which could indicate some availability for new residents or investors looking to enter the market. The financial profile of ZIP 91941 is notably strong, with a median household income of $111,607. This figure points to a relatively affluent community, where residents likely enjoy a comfortable standard of living and disposable income for local businesses to tap into. Housing costs, however, reflect the premium nature of the area. The median house value stands at $884,800, positioning ZIP 91941 as a high-value real estate market. For renters, the median rent is $2,067 per month, which aligns with the elevated cost of living in this part of California. ZIP 91941 boasts a diverse cultural makeup, enriching the community with varied perspectives and traditions. The racial composition includes 55.57% White, 26.12% Hispanic, 6.69% Black, and 4.66% Asian residents, with the remainder comprising other or mixed-race individuals.
